How do I create a custom taxonomy in WooCommerce?

Go to the 'CPT UI' section in the left of the WordPress admin and click on the 'Add/Edit Taxonomies' section:

  1. Add the Taxonomy Slug (ideally 1 word, lowercase).
  2. Add a plural and singular name (label) for your WooCommerce custom taxonomy. ...
  3. Attach it to the Products post type.
  4. Click 'Add Taxonomy'.

How do I create a custom post type in WordPress?

The first thing you need to do is install and activate the Custom Post Type UI plugin. Upon activation, the plugin will add a new menu item in your WordPress admin menu called CPT UI. Now go to CPT UI » Add New to create a new custom post type. First, you need to provide a slug for your custom post type.

How do I create a custom tag in WordPress?

Register taxonomy And Post Type

Edit your theme functions. php or plugin file to register taxonomy for custom tag like so. Now go to WordPress admin dashboard and flush the rewrite rules by clicking "Save Changes" in "Permalink Settings". You should now be able to add custom tags to your Custom post types.

Are tags taxonomies?

A tag is similar to a category. It's a term in the post_tag taxonomy. So if you have WordPress and tutorials as tags for your posts, they are terms in the post_tag taxonomy.
